Matthew G. Kovalcik,
CFP® PartnerMatt graduated from Franklin University with a Bachelor of Science in Business Administration in Marketing in 1993. Matt earned the marks of CERTIFIED FINANCIAL PLANNER™ (CFP®) in 1997. Matt is currently a second-level candidate for the Chartered Market Technician (CMT) designation.
In 1998 Matt formed M.G. Kovalcik, LLC and provided financial planning and investment advisory services to clients employing a fee-based approach. In 2005, he merged his practice with Steve to form Kovalcik & Geraghty Wealth Partners LLP (KGWP) and is currently Co-Managing Partner. KGWP completed its transition to a Fee-Only planning practice in 2012 further reinforcing their role as fiduciaries for their clients.
From 2013-2019 Matt served on the Board of Directors of the Bluffton Boys and Girls Club. He currently serves as the treasurer of Friends of Worship on the Water which is a non-profit outreach ministry in Bluffton, SC.
